The cluster for Innovation in Health of the Campus Moncloa has four main areas of action which include the telemedicine and the most advance equipment in magnetic resonance.
The areas of research of the cluster for Innovation in Health are: design and synthesis of diagnostic and therapeutic tools, biomedical imaging platform, medical information and the Living-Lab platform.
Amongst the new facilities associated to the cluster for Innovation in Health, there is a virtual reality room in the Living-lab to carry out, for example, experiences of rehabilitation, treatment of phobias and improving learning processes in people with autism.
Under the Innocampus Project of the Ministry of Economy and Finance, the cluster for Innovation in Health can fund other equipment of the CAI Nuclear Magnetic Resonance, one of them is the most powerful magnetic resonance device supported by the international medical bodies for the scientific study of the morphology of the human body.
